the worldwide eco-friendly Gauntlet: comprehending International Environmental laws
The force to undertake greener tactics just isn't localized; It is just a coordinated worldwide movement. Factories, Primarily These with the eye around the export market, have to be fluent from the language of international environmental legislation.
In Europe: The regulatory framework is experienced and thorough. The get to (Registration, Evaluation, Authorisation and Restriction of Chemicals) regulation controls the usage of chemical substances, requiring substantial data for just about any material imported or created in portions about 1 tonne a year. The RoHS (Restriction of harmful Substances) directive especially restrictions the usage of substances like direct, mercury, cadmium, and hexavalent chromium in electrical and Digital machines—straight impacting platers who serve this large field. The WEEE (squander Electrical and Digital Equipment) directive complements this by taking care of the disposal and recycling of such products and solutions, placing additional emphasis on building for sustainability.
In the United States: The Environmental security Agency (EPA) enforces strict guidelines on air and h2o pollution. The poisonous Substances Command Act (TSCA) presents the EPA authority to control chemicals, whilst the Clean h2o Act sets stringent restrictions to the discharge of pollutants, such as hefty metals from plating functions. limitations on unstable natural and organic Compounds (VOCs) also have an effect on using specific cleaners and additives inside the plating method.
In Asia: The pattern is accelerating swiftly. China's Dual Carbon system (peaking carbon emissions by 2030 and obtaining carbon neutrality by 2060) places huge strain on Electrical power-intensive industries like electroplating to improve efficiency. plan, unannounced environmental inspections have become the norm. equally, South Korea's K-REACH along with other national polices across the continent mirror the stringent demands in their European counterparts, closing loopholes for non-compliant producers.
The Main Challenge: Environmental Hurdles inside the Plating Industry
Electroplating factories deal with a unique list of environmental soreness points rooted within their Main processes. Addressing these difficulties is the initial step towards An effective update.
intricate Wastewater treatment method: This is certainly arguably the most significant hurdle inside the plating industry. Plating wastewater is a complex mixture made up of dissolved heavy metals for instance zinc, nickel, and chromium, in conjunction with cyanides, acids, alkalis, and various complexing brokers. Treating this sort of effluent to meet significantly stringent discharge restrictions is not just high priced but in addition calls for a major Bodily footprint for treatment method amenities, along with Superior equipment and continuous checking. The worries don’t halt there—inefficient procedures that deliver higher amounts of steel ions in rinse water bring on bigger therapy fees, higher environmental threats, and even more stringent oversight by regulators. As environmental regulations tighten around the world, companies are beneath expanding stress to search out more sustainable and price-powerful answers for controlling their wastewater treatment method procedures.
harmful Chemical Formulations: conventional plating formulations, though powerful at obtaining significant-top quality finishes, will often be created on really harmful and outdated chemistries. For example, cyanide-based mostly plating baths have very long been employed due to their excellent plating Qualities, However they have intense wellness, basic safety, and environmental challenges. Cyanide is exceptionally harmful to humans, wildlife, and ecosystems, producing these formulations a main concentrate on for stricter rules. On top of that, the hazardous nature of these substances tends to make transportation, storage, and handling a substantial worry. As regulatory organizations continue on to crack down, securing environmental permits for new services or renewing permits for existing types that still use this kind of legacy chemistries has started to become increasingly difficult. corporations will have to now take into consideration transitioning to safer, more environmentally friendly alternatives to stay compliant.
procedure Inefficiency and squander technology: Inefficiencies in plating procedures are A serious drain on both of those the ecosystem and operational budgets. small present performance, in which Electricity is wasted throughout the method by creating hydrogen fuel as an alternative to depositing metal proficiently, drives up Power consumption and improves operational costs. This inefficiency contributes to a larger carbon footprint, specifically for plating operations with higher Electrical power demands. Furthermore, unstable plating baths often result in a cycle of "disaster administration" for operators, who're compelled to include extreme amounts of brighteners, stabilizers, or other additives to keep up bath effectiveness. These overcorrections produce larger use of substances, extra organic breakdown items, and higher quantities of bulk plating chemical suppliers sludge in wastewater therapy methods. The result is improved squander, larger disposal expenses, and a compounding environmental effect, all of which make the plating course of action considerably less sustainable in the long term.
The good Switch: deciding upon Eco-Compliant Plating Additives
The only most impactful transform a plating factory may make would be to improve its core chemistry. When assessing new plating chemical substances, notably acid zinc plating chemicals which happen to be a well-liked eco-friendlier substitute, numerous important metrics need to be viewed as.
large existing Efficiency: hunt for additives that promise a recent performance of over 90%. This means a lot more of your Vitality is useful for its supposed reason—plating. the advantages are threefold: reduced Electrical power use, a lot quicker plating speeds (bigger efficiency), and reduced risk of hydrogen embrittlement in high-power metal elements.
clean up and secure Formulations: The ideal zinc plating chemical must be cyanide-absolutely free and contain negligible to no limited significant metals. A superior formulation continues to be secure in excess of a variety of working problems, lowering the necessity for Repeated, reactive additions. This stability causes fewer organic contamination from the bathtub and, As a result, a less complicated wastewater remedy load.
Verifiable knowledge and Certification: don't just take marketing statements at deal with price. reliable plating chemical suppliers will commonly deliver comprehensive technical documentation. This includes a specialized information Sheet (TDS) detailing operational parameters, a Material protection facts Sheet (MSDS) for Harmless handling, and, most significantly, 3rd-bash lab reports confirming compliance with standards like RoHS and access.
Sustainable Partnerships: take into account the provider's have environmental credentials. Do they engage in sustainable packaging? Is their manufacturing facility certified for thoroughly clean output? Partnering with a provider who shares your dedication to sustainability produces a much better, more defensible inexperienced supply chain.
further than the bathtub: Upgrading generation Management and Process Management
Switching to an improved chemical is simply A part of the solution. True compliance is realized when environmentally friendly chemistry is paired with smart operational management.
put into practice 6S Shop flooring Management: A clean up, structured workspace (form, established as a way, Shine, Standardize, Sustain, basic safety) is the foundation of environmental Manage. It minimizes spills, prevents cross-contamination of baths, decreases incidents, and fosters a society of precision and treatment.
build Automated Command techniques: shift faraway from manual titration and guesswork. utilizing online sensors for pH, concentration, and temperature, coupled with automatic dosing units, ensures the plating bath is always running in its optimal window. This precision minimizes chemical intake, ensures dependable high quality, and dramatically lowers squander.
put money into team Training: Your workforce must fully grasp not merely the way to use new eco-welcoming reagents, but why they are crucial. Training ought to go over Secure handling, the environmental impact in their operate, and the proper techniques for reducing squander and responding to spills.
develop Environmental Accountability: Appoint a focused environmental officer or crew answerable for checking compliance, tracking useful resource consumption (water, Power, chemical substances), and running waste streams. connection environmental general performance indicators (KPIs) to group or personal functionality critiques to embed accountability all through the Firm.
